30. Push the electrical connector (4) onto its location and tighten in position, connect the three
pneumatic connectors (1-3).
– Reconnect the down feed pneumatic tube (1) - 4mm tube labelled 1.
– Reconnect the up feed pneumatic tube (2) - 4mm tube labelled 2.
– Reconnect the paste pressure feed pneumatic tube (3) - 6mm tube.

31. Switch the pneumatic isolator to SUP.
32. Refit the front panel.
33. Refit upper left hand side panel.
34. Switch the mains isolator to ON.
NOTE
During initialization, the paste dispenser will return to its home position automatically.

9.4.1.2 Jar to Cartridge
1. Select the Changeover tab.
2. Select Start Changeover.
3. Select Continue.
4. Select Carriage To Rear.
5. Select Menu.
6. Select Shut Down.
7. Open the front cover.
8. Ensure that the stencil has been removed.
9. Switch the mains isolator to OFF.
10. Remove the front panel.
11. Turn the pneumatic isolator to EXH.
12. Remove the upper left hand side panel.
13. Remove the paste jar from the paste dispenser.
